Processed Meat Product Inspector
A profession that conducts various inspections on processed meat products such as sausages, ham, and bacon regarding ingredients, hygiene, and quality to confirm safety and compliance with standards.
Seafood Processing Inspector
A profession that inspects the quality and safety of seafood such as fish and shellfish during processing stages and confirms compliance with standards.
Seafood Processed Product Inspector
Seafood processed product inspectors evaluate the quality, safety, and standards compliance of processed products such as canned goods, minced products, and dried goods made from seafood using various inspection techniques, and confirm that they meet shipping standards.
Can Inspection Machine Operator (Canned Goods: Food Products)
This occupation involves using a can inspection machine in the canned food manufacturing process to inspect metal cans for abnormalities such as scratches, dents, and leaks.
Can Tester (Canned Food)
A profession that performs tap testing on the cans of canned food products, determines the presence or absence of abnormalities from the sound and appearance, and selects products that do not meet quality standards.
Bread Inspector
A job that inspects the appearance and quality of products on the bread production line to confirm compliance with standards.
